Ministry of Finance relocates to Kanda, begins full operations Feb 9
The Ministry of Finance has officially relocated its offices to Kanda in Accra as part of efforts to improve operational efficiency and service delivery.
In a statement issued on Friday, February 6, 2026, the Ministry announced that it will commence full operations at the new location from Monday, February 9.
According to the Dr Cassiel A.B. Forson-led ministry, the relocation forms part of ongoing measures to enhance coordination, responsiveness and overall effectiveness in the discharge of its mandate.
It noted that the new office facility at Kanda was constructed by the Ghana Revenue Authority (GRA) prior to the current administration assuming office.
The ministry indicated that all official correspondence, visits and inquiries should henceforth be directed to the new premises.
The new address details are: Ministry of Finance, Tumu Avenue, Kanda – Accra, with digital address GV-002-6511 and postal address P.O. Box MB 40, Ministries, Accra.
However, the ministry’s contact telephone numbers, email addresses and website remain unchanged.
For further information, the public may contact the ministry via telephone on +233 302 747 197 or email at info@mofep.gov.gh.
The ministry expressed appreciation to stakeholders and assured the public of its commitment to improving service delivery from the new premises.
